The loans will support the construction of five projects that each host two big nuclear reactors.

The DOE plans $17.5 billion in low-interest loans for Westinghouse AP1000 nuclear reactors, targeting ten new units as part of an $80 billion partnership.

The new nuclear funding will specifically finance 10 large reactors developed by both utilities and energy companies.

The Trump administration is providing $17.5 billion to speed the development of 10 new large nuclear reactors to meet the skyrocketing power demand from massive data centers.
